How would you convert methylamine to ethylamine?

Here, methyl amine is first reacted with nitric acid to form methanol which on treating with hydrochloric acid and zinc chloride to form methyl chloride. Methyl chloride is then reacted with potassium cyanide to form methyl cyanide. Methyl cyanide is then reduced using lithium aluminium hydride to form ethyl amine.

How is methyl iodide converted to ethylamine?

Methyl iodide reacts with alcoholic solution of potassium cyanide (KCN) to give ethane nitrile (or methyl cyanide) as the major product with a small amount of potassium iodide. Ethane nitrile (or methyl cyanide) on reduction with sodium and alcohol (Mendius reaction) forms ethyl amine.

How can you tell the difference between aniline and ethylamine?

Ethylamine and aniline can be distinguished from each other by the azo-dye test. A dye is obtained when aniline (an aromatic amine) reacts with HNO2 (NaNO2 + dil. HCl) at 0-5°C, followed by a reaction with the alkaline solution of 2-naphthol.

How is ethylamine prepared from a methyl cyanide B acetamide?

Ethylamine is produced when acetamide is reduced using LiAlH4 or sodium and alcohol. Acetamide is reduced using sodium and absolute alcohol or LiAlH4 in ether or hydrogen in the presence of a nickel catalyst to produce ethylamine. CH3CONH2LiAlH4→Na + C2H5OHCH3CH2NH2+ H2O .

How is ethylamine prepared from propionamide?

Propionamide can be converted to ethanamine with Hoffman bromamide reaction. In Hoffman bromamide reaction, an amide is treated with Br2/KOH to get a primary amine with 1 C-atom less. When propionamide is treated with Br2/KOH, ethyl amine is formed.

What happens when ethylamine reacts with bromoethane?

The ethylamine also reacts with bromoethane – in the same two stages as before. In the first stage, you get a salt formed – this time, diethylammonium bromide. Think of this as ammonium bromide with two hydrogens replaced by ethyl groups. There is again the possibility of a reversible reaction between this salt and excess ammonia in the mixture.
